Ordered that the judgment is affirmed.
Resolution of issues of credibility, as well as the weight to be accorded the evidence presented, are primarily questions to be determined by the trier of fact, who saw and heard the witnesses (see People v Gaimari, 176 N.Y. 84, 94 [1903]).
